Taut develops artificial intelligence technology grounded in neuroscience and information theory to address current AI limitations. This approach enables robust, efficient, and transparent problem-solving with significantly reduced data and computational demands. The company provides a new foundation for intelligent applications requiring high interpretability and security.

Problem
Current machine‑learning systems demand massive labeled datasets, extensive compute cycles, and operate as black‑box models that are vulnerable to adversarial manipulation and difficult to interpret. This combination limits deployment on resource‑constrained devices and hampers trust in high‑stakes applications such as security‑critical vision or autonomous control. Consequently, organizations face high operational costs and regulatory barriers when scaling AI solutions.
Solution
Taut applies a neuroscience‑inspired computational framework that integrates principles from signal processing and information theory to construct models that learn efficiently from limited examples. By leveraging hierarchical predictive coding and sparse coding mechanisms, the platform reduces data and compute requirements while preserving predictive performance. The architecture embeds explicit uncertainty estimates and causal reasoning pathways, delivering transparent inference that can be audited for security and compliance. Built‑in robustness mechanisms, such as biologically‑derived regularization, mitigate adversarial perturbations and improve stability across distribution shifts. Taut’s solution is delivered as a modular library and cloud‑hosted inference service, enabling seamless integration with existing ML pipelines and edge‑device deployments.

Features
- Hierarchical predictive‑coding networks that achieve few‑shot learning with up to 80 % fewer training samples compared to conventional deep nets
- Sparse, energy‑efficient inference engine optimized for low‑power CPUs and edge ASICs, reducing runtime power consumption by up to 60 %
- Built‑in Bayesian uncertainty quantification that surfaces confidence scores for every prediction, supporting interpretability and risk assessment
- Adversarial‑resilience layer based on biologically‑inspired regularization, providing provable bounds against common perturbation attacks
- Modular API compatible with TensorFlow, PyTorch, and ONNX, allowing drop‑in replacement of existing model components
- Real‑time model introspection dashboard that visualizes activation pathways and feature attribution for regulatory audit trails
- Scalable cloud inference service with auto‑scaling and secure, end‑to‑end encrypted data transport
- Edge‑deployment toolkit that packages models into containerized runtimes for IoT, robotics, and mobile platforms
